c='$a$b',c就等于$a$b字符,也相当于c=\$a\$b
cut,截取字符串;-d指定分隔符;
8.11 sort_wc_uniq命令
sort排序;
特殊符号排在最前,然后数字,然后字母顺序
-n的话,字母表示为0;
wc -l统计行数,-m统计全部字符数(含隐藏字符);-w word单词;
uniq去重复;#uniq 2.txt;
需要先排序,再去重,命令为#sort 2.txt | uniq -c
以上操作,不会更改文件内容,只是处理显示结果;
8.12 tee_tr_split命令
tee 表示>;
tee -a 表示追加>>;
tr 'a' 'A'将a替换为A;
split切割,大文件切割成小文件,比如日志文件;
-b指定大小切割,默认B字节为单位,100M就以兆为单位;
-l指定行数切割;
切割并指定前缀#split -b 100k a.txt abc
查看切割后的每个文件大小#du -sh x*
删除所有小文件#rm -f x*
8.13 shell特殊符号下
||表示或;&&表示与,命令都执行;
相关测验题目:http://ask.apelearn.com/question/5437
扩展
1. source exec 区别 http://alsww.blog.51cto.com/2001924/1113112
2. Linux特殊符号大全http://ask.apelearn.com/question/7720
3. sort并未按ASCII排序 http://blog.csdn.net/zenghui08/article/details/7938975
原文地址:http://blog.51cto.com/12059818/2084722